EKSG WARNS AGAINST BUILDING ON WATERWAYS.

Ekiti State Government has warned residents against reckless blockage of drains, culverts and canals which could lead to erosion as theraining season is fast approaching. The Commissioner for Information, Rt. Hon Taiwo Olatunbosun gave the warning during an on-the-site inspection of illegal structures blocking waterways along Bawa-Iworoko Road. Rt. Hon. EKSG FUMIGATES ILOKUN DUMPSITE

Ekiti State Government has fumigated the main dumpsite in the State capital situated along Ilokun to protect residents and prevent health hazards. The State Commissioner for Environment and Natural Resources, Erelu Tosin Aluko Ajisafe said that the move was to make the sites safer for waste management operations. Ekiti Govt. Halts Moves By Kingmakers, Youth to Depose Monarch

The Ekiti State Government, on Tuesday, mediated in the crisis brewing in Ayegunle Community in Ijero Local Government Area of the State and halted attempt being made by kingmakers and youth to dethrone Oba Johnson Aderiye. EKITI COMMENCES RESTRUCTURING OF FARM SETTLEMENTS, ESTABLISHMENT OF CLUSTER FARMS

Ekiti State Government has commenced the restructuring of farm settlements as part of efforts to promote efficient utilization of land resources and dignity in farming with the provision of basic social needs and ultimately boost food security in the State.
